设置和取消CRON作业

时间:2011-03-28 09:42:23

标签: php cron

我希望能够使用PHP做一些事情:设置CRON以在特定时刻(简单)运行特定文件,同时获取该作业的某种ID,这将允许我跟踪/或在工作开始之前取消工作。我会在我的数据库中跟踪这些ID。

2 个答案:

答案 0 :(得分:2)

通过PHP直接与系统文件混淆cron并不是一个好主意。

  • 我会首先设置一个主cron作业文件,设置为每5分钟运行一次,之后将控制所有任务
  • 构建一个可靠的数据库后端,您可以在其中存储任务(脚本,开始时间,频率等)。
  • 构建一个面板,您可以在其中管理任务,启动它们,保存它们等等。

答案 1 :(得分:1)

与您的网络托管服务商联系。除了从命令行或脚本运行cron之外,一些Web管理面板(如CPanel)还有一个用于设置cron作业的图形界面。